网络流量分析检测如何识别和防范DDoS攻击?
随着互联网的快速发展,网络安全问题日益凸显。其中,DDoS攻击作为一种常见的网络攻击手段,给企业和个人带来了巨大的损失。为了保护网络安全,网络流量分析检测技术应运而生。本文将深入探讨网络流量分析检测如何识别和防范DDoS攻击。
一、DDoS攻击概述
DDoS攻击(Distributed Denial of Service)即分布式拒绝服务攻击,是指攻击者通过控制大量僵尸网络(Botnet)对目标服务器发起大规模的网络请求,导致目标服务器资源耗尽,无法正常提供服务。DDoS攻击具有以下特点:
- 攻击规模大:攻击者可以利用僵尸网络发起大规模攻击,短时间内造成目标服务器瘫痪。
- 攻击手段多样:攻击者可以采用多种攻击手段,如TCP/IP协议攻击、应用层攻击等。
- 攻击目标广泛:DDoS攻击可以针对任何网络设备或服务,如网站、游戏服务器、数据库等。
二、网络流量分析检测技术
网络流量分析检测技术是一种基于对网络流量进行实时监测、分析和处理的技术。通过分析网络流量,可以发现异常行为,从而识别和防范DDoS攻击。
1. 流量采集
首先,需要采集网络流量数据。这可以通过部署流量采集设备或使用现有的网络设备来实现。采集到的流量数据包括IP地址、端口号、协议类型、数据包大小等信息。
2. 异常检测
通过对采集到的流量数据进行实时分析,可以发现异常行为。常见的异常检测方法包括:
- 统计方法:通过计算流量数据的统计指标,如流量速率、流量大小等,与正常值进行比较,发现异常。
- 机器学习方法:利用机器学习算法对流量数据进行训练,建立正常流量模型,然后对实时流量数据进行预测,发现异常。
3. DDoS攻击识别
在异常检测过程中,需要识别出DDoS攻击。以下是一些常见的DDoS攻击识别方法:
- 流量速率异常:DDoS攻击通常会短时间内产生大量流量,导致流量速率异常。
- 流量分布异常:DDoS攻击通常会针对特定目标发起攻击,导致流量分布异常。
- 数据包特征异常:DDoS攻击通常会使用特定的数据包特征,如数据包大小、协议类型等。
4. 防范措施
一旦识别出DDoS攻击,需要采取相应的防范措施。以下是一些常见的防范措施:
- 流量清洗:将攻击流量从正常流量中分离出来,减轻目标服务器的压力。
- 黑洞路由:将攻击流量引导到黑洞路由器,使其无法到达目标服务器。
- 流量限制:对异常流量进行限制,防止其影响正常业务。
三、案例分析
以下是一个DDoS攻击的案例分析:
案例背景:某知名电商平台在上线新产品时,遭到一次DDoS攻击。攻击者利用僵尸网络对电商平台的服务器发起攻击,导致服务器瘫痪,用户无法正常访问。
应对措施:电商平台采取了以下措施:
- 流量清洗:与专业的流量清洗服务商合作,将攻击流量从正常流量中分离出来。
- 黑洞路由:将攻击流量引导到黑洞路由器,防止其到达目标服务器。
- 流量限制:对异常流量进行限制,防止其影响正常业务。
通过以上措施,电商平台成功抵御了DDoS攻击,保障了用户正常访问。
四、总结
网络流量分析检测技术在识别和防范DDoS攻击方面发挥着重要作用。通过实时监测、分析和处理网络流量,可以发现异常行为,从而识别和防范DDoS攻击。企业应加强网络安全防护,利用网络流量分析检测技术,保障网络安全。
猜你喜欢:云原生APM